- Harvard Medical School (HMS) admissions are competitive, with acceptance rates in the single digits due to numerous applicants.
- Strong academic performance is vital; typical GPA requirements are above 3.5 and successful candidates often average 3.75.
- Applicants must complete coursework in biology, chemistry, physics, and mathematics, with specific lab experience required.
- HMS values non-academic attributes such as integrity, leadership skills, and a genuine concern for others, evaluated through essays and interviews.
- Experience in healthcare settings, including clinical shadowing and community work, is highly recommended to strengthen applications.
